We apologize for the issue you are facing while trying to connect your Rank Math account to your Mail Services. It seems like there might be a problem with the connection process that is redirecting you back to your WordPress dashboard.
To troubleshoot this issue, we recommend checking the following:
- Ensure that your website URL is correctly set in the WordPress settings.
- Clear your browser cache and cookies, then try connecting again.
- Disable any conflicting plugins temporarily to see if that resolves the issue.

For initial troubleshooting, please make sure you’re using the latest version of the Rank Math plugin on your website: https://rankmath.com/changelog/free/
After that, please check if there’s some security rule inside your .htaccess
file which may prevent saving the settings.
You can also use the default .htaccess
file from here: https://wordpress.org/support/article/htaccess/
Please do take a complete backup of your website before modifying your .htaccess as it is a sensitive file.
If the issue persists, you can follow this guideline to check if any of your plugins/themes are conflicting with Rank Math: https://rankmath.com/kb/check-plugin-conflicts/
